Portugal - Number of Beds in Not for Profit Privately Owned Hospitals
Since 2014, Portugal Number of Beds in Not for Profit Privately Owned Hospitals grew 1.6% year on year. With 7,368 Hospital Beds in 2019, the country was number 11 among other countries in Number of Beds in Not for Profit Privately Owned Hospitals. Portugal is overtaken by Italy, which was ranked number 10 with 7,488 Hospital Beds and is followed by Israel with 5,334 Hospital Beds. South Korea lead the ranking with 593,154 Hospital Beds in 2019, a growth of 2.6% versus 2018. United States, Germany and France resp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Israel recorded the best 5 years average growth at +3% per year, while Estonia witnessed the worst performance at -3.9% per year.
